SQL Server 中,角色是一个新概念。使用数据库角色有什么意义呢?    我们新增了7个固定的服务器角色和9个固定的数据库角色。服务器角色是分散系统管理员工作的一个办法。在SQL Server 6.5和更早的版本中,有一个叫做“sa”的帐号,这个帐号可以在数据库服务器上做任何事情。在那时,你可以有10个Windows NT用户被映射成“sa”,这意味着这10个用户都可以在任何时间
# SQL Server 数据库角色的创建与管理 在数据库管理中,角色扮演着极其重要的作用。角色是一组权限的集合,可以使我们更有效地管理用户权限,确保系统的安全性。本文将带您了解如何在 SQL Server 中创建和管理数据库角色,并提供一系列的步骤和代码示例。 ## 流程概述 为了创建和管理 SQL Server 数据库角色,您需要按照以下步骤进行: | 步骤 | 描述
原创 10月前
195阅读
# 深入理解 SQL Server 数据库角色SQL Server 中,数据库安全性是一个非常重要的方面,而数据库角色则是实现这一安全性的主要工具之一。本文将为大家介绍 SQL Server 中的数据库角色,包括其概念、类型、使用方法和代码示例。 ## 什么是数据库角色数据库角色是一种用于管理 SQL Server 数据库用户权限的工具。通过将用户添加到角色中,可以轻松地分配权限,
原创 10月前
153阅读
当几个用户需要在某个特定的数据库中执行类似的动作时(这里没有相应的Windows用户组),就可以向该数据库中添加一个角色(role)。数据库角色指定了可以访问相同数据库对象的一组数据库用户。数据库角色的成员可以分为如下几类:Windows用户组或用户账户SQL Server登录其他角色SQL Server的安全体系结构中包括了几个含有特定隐含权限的角色。除了数据库拥有者创建的角色之外,还有两类预定
 当数据库越来越多,连接到数据库的应用程序,服务器,账号越来越多的时候,为了既能达到满足账号操作数据权限需求,又不扩大其操作权限,保证数据库的安全性,有时候需要用角色来参与到权限管理中,通过角色做一个权限与访问用不之前的映射,可以更加方便地管理权限。USE master GO --创建一个用户 CREATE LOGIN ReadUser WITH PASSWORD ='123qwe!@#
---数据库的安全管理--登录:SQL Server数据库服务器登录的身份验证模式:1)Windows身份验证。2)Windows和SQL Server混合验证 --角色:分类:1)服务器角色。服务器角色是固定的服务器功能,用户不能创建和修改服务器角色。可以将服务器的登录账号添加服务器角色中,使其具备服务器角色的权限。2)数据库角色数据库角色的作用对象是某一个数据库,用来将登录数据库
---数据库的安全管理--登录:SQL Server数据库服务器登录的身份验证模式:1)Windows身份验证。2)Windows和SQL Server混合验证 --角色:分类:1)服务器角色。服务器角色是固定的服务器功能,用户不能创建和修改服务器角色。可以将服务器的登录账号添加服务器角色中,使其具备服务器角色的权限。2)数据库角色数据库角色的作用对象是某一个数据库,用来将登录数据库
转载 2023-06-20 14:07:14
174阅读
当几个用户需要在某个特定的数据库中执行类似的动作时(这里没有相应的Windows用户组),就可以向该数据库中添加一个角色(role)。数据库角色指定了可以访问相同数据库对象的一组数据库用户。数据库角色的成员可以分为如下几类:Windows用户组或用户账户SQL Server登录其他角色SQL Server的安全体系结构中包括了几个含有特定隐含权限的角色。除了数据库拥有者创建的角色之外,还有两类预定
mssql提权一、mssqlmssql ===> Microsoft sql server mssql 默认的管理员权限的用户名叫做sa1. mssql基础语句create database xxx 创建数据库 create table 创建表 使用use 来使用特定的数据库 select * from 名.表名.字段名 mssql 不存在limit语法 使用top 语法,来实现lim
# SQL Server数据库角色设置密码教程 在企业应用中,数据库的安全性是重中之重。设置数据库角色的密码可以帮助确保只有授权用户才能访问特定的数据库资源。本篇文章将引导你了解如何在SQL Server中设置数据库角色的密码,包括每一步的详细操作和相应的代码示例。 ## 整体流程 以下是设置SQL Server数据库角色密码的基本流程: | 步骤 | 描述
原创 9月前
35阅读
# 如何实现"SQL Server数据库主体拥有数据库角色" ## 简介 在SQL Server数据库中,主体是数据库中的实体,而角色则是一组权限和访问控制的集合。通过将数据库主体分配给数据库角色,可以实现对数据库对象的授权和权限管理。本文将引导你了解如何在SQL Server中实现数据库主体拥有数据库角色的操作流程和具体步骤。 ## 操作流程 下面是实现"SQL Server数据库主体拥有数
原创 2023-10-01 06:45:07
48阅读
服务器角色publicsysadmin--在 SQL Server 中进行任何活动。该角色的权限跨越所有其它固定服务器角色。serveradmin --配置服务器范围的设置。setupadmin --添加和删除链接服务器,并执行某些系统存储过程(如 sp_serveroption)。securityadmin --管理服务器登录。processadmin --管理在 SQL Server 实例中运
原创 2月前
152阅读
固定数据库服务器角色 SYSADMIN 系统管理员角色: 拥有 sql server系统的所有权限许可; SETUPADMIN 安装管理员角色: 拥有 增加、删除链接服务器、建立数据库复制以及管理扩展存储过程的权限许可; SERVERA
在 ASP.NET 应用服务的 SQL Server 提供者数据库中包括有许多的数据库对象(例如,存储过程和数据表)以支持 ASP.NET 的成员资格、角色管理、档案、Web Parts 个性化、以及 Web 事件等特征。该数据库中包括的角色和视图只用于对支持指定特征的必需对象进行访问。这能够让你授予 SQL Server 数据库连接以最小的必需权限,从而改进应用程序的安全。 数据库角色 数据库
要想成功访问 SQL Server 数据库中的数据, 我们需要两个方面的授权:获得准许连接 SQL Server 服务器的权利;获得访问特定数据库数据的权利(select, update, delete, create table ...)。 假设,我们准备建立一个 dba 数据库帐户,用来管理数据库 mydb。 1. 首先在 SQL Server 服务器级别,创建登陆帐户(create lo
# SQL Server 数据库角色只允许查询 在现代信息管理中,数据库的安全性与灵活性是至关重要的。SQL Server 提供了角色和权限管理的功能,以便根据不同需求控制用户对数据的访问权。在许多情况下,您可能只希望某些用户能够查询数据,而无法进行插入、更新或删除操作。本文将介绍如何在 SQL Server 中设置一个只允许查询的角色,并提供相应的代码示例和说明。 ## 1. 理解角色与权限
原创 2024-10-01 06:52:59
94阅读
数据库角色限制在单个数据库的范围之内——用户属于一个数据库中的db_datareader角色并不意味着他属于另一个数据库中的那个角色数据库角色分为两个子类:固定数据库角色和用户定义数据库角色。 1.固定数据库角色 就如同存在若干个固定服务器角色一样,这里也有许多 的固定数据库角色。他们中的一些有预先定义好的专门的用途,这是不能使用常规的语句复制出来的(即是说,你无法创建拥有同样功能的
转载 2023-12-29 19:03:12
65阅读
  服务器角色     bulkadmin 这个角色可以运行BULK INSERT语句.该语句允许从文本文件中将数据导入到SQL Server2008数据库中,为需要执行大容量插入到数据库的域帐号而设计.     dbcreator 这个角色可以创建,更改,删除和还原任何数据库.不仅适合助理DBA角色,也可能适合开发人员角色.     diskadmin 这个角色用于管理磁盘文件,比如镜像数据库
转载 2021-01-22 19:45:51
556阅读
首先我们来阐述服务器(实例级别)的权限,实例级别和数据库级别权限的最大不同在于:实例级别的权限是直接授权给登录名,而数据库级别的全显示授予数据库用户的,然后数据库用户再与登录名匹配。(再SqlServer中,登录名和用户是两个概念,登录名用于登录到数据库实例,而用户位于数据库之内,用于和登录名匹配)举例:--指定登录名为dbtester,并且创建test数据库中的用户tester1 execute
1.在SQL Server中,用户和角色是分为服务器级别和数据库级别的2.服务器级别登录名:指有权限登录到某服务器的用户,例如超级管理员的登录名是sa;              登录名具体位置在  数据库——>安全性——>登录名          &nbs
转载 2023-06-28 15:21:23
447阅读
  • 1
  • 2
  • 3
  • 4
  • 5